December is here and you can act now to help out a child in need this holiday season. By donating to the Connecticut Education Foundation’s (CEF) Holiday Bear Project, you can brighten the holidays for a child who would otherwise go without gifts this year.
“Every year, our members, our staff, and civic-minded organizations open up their hearts to some of our neediest students across Connecticut,” says CEA Vice President and CEF President Tom Nicholas. “This year, because of COVID-19, many more families have experienced job loss, illness, or food and housing insecurity. The Holiday Bear Project will help bring much needed joy and relief to those families and children.”
Due to Covid-19, the traditional Holiday Bear Project has been revised into a virtual program this year where each child will receive a $50 gift card in a holiday box. The Connecticut Post Mall and iHeartCommunities have teamed up to raise cash donations to support the Holiday Bear Program.
